Current event Journal "Guns Are Our Shared Responsibilty"

         The author of this op-ed is a very well known figure in the United states, Barack Obama and he gave his opinion and thoughts on how to help with the "crisis" of gun violence. He gives statistics of number of deaths in the united states to show his reasoning and how citizens are a big part in stopping this issue that will take time to be stopped. He also points fingers at the gun industry because they are making any improvements on the safety measures of guns like how easy it is for kids to use them or any adults to buy them. 
         Obama is trying to get the readers of this article (mainly citizens of the United States) to help with the crisis of gun violence because that is the only way that it will be solved. He is doing so by showing examples like the 15 year old who jumped in front of gunfire to save three girls and also was reaching out to the people to realize the problem we are having with guns in the states. His main focus was to inform the reader about gun violence but he does so by trying to get on an emotional level with the reader by giving reference to an actual kid who died due to this or by showing that women, gay, and African Americans rights took time to be solved but with the help of citizens uniting to make a change it has affected the United states greatly.
